2024春季版串口调试工具*.**.*.***14 LTSC功能详解

需积分: 0 1 下载量 97 浏览量 更新于2024-10-09 收藏 10.07MB ZIP 举报
资源摘要信息:"常用串口调试工具2024春季版(*.**.*.***14 LTSC)" 1. 串口调试工具概述 串口调试工具是一种常用于微控制器、嵌入式设备、PC机或其他支持串口通信的设备之间进行数据交换和调试的软件。这种工具能够帮助开发者和工程师们监控、发送以及接收串口数据流。它们通常支持多波特率、数据位、停止位、校验方式等串口通信参数的配置,以及多种数据格式(如文本模式、HEX模式、报文模式)的发送与接收。 2. 波特率及其限制 波特率是指串口通信的速率,它代表每秒钟可以传输的符号(比特)数。在该串口调试工具中,支持多达数十种波特率,从最低的110波特到高达1382400波特,甚至更高。需要注意的是,尽管软件支持多种波特率,但最终能实现的波特率受硬件(如串口控制器、电缆质量、接口类型等)的限制。 3. 数据格式与通信模式 串口数据收发支持文本模式和HEX模式,这意味着用户可以根据需要选择发送和接收数据的格式。文本模式通常用于发送和接收可打印字符,而HEX模式则用于发送和接收十六进制编码的数据。此外,工具还支持报文模式和数据模式,使用户能够以特定的格式和协议发送和接收数据。 4. 数据管理与导出功能 为了便于数据处理和报告,该工具提供了数据管理功能,包括自动保存接收数据、支持手动一键保存数据、支持查询历史数据、手动保存接收与发送的数据,以及数据导出至EXCEL报表、存储于数据库。这些功能可以极大地提高数据记录、分析和报告生成的效率。 5. 校验与数据位 为了确保数据传输的准确性和可靠性,该串口调试工具支持多种校验方式(None、even、odd、space、mark)和数据位长度(5,6,7,8)。校验位用于检测数据在传输过程中是否出错,数据位则决定了每个字符的大小,不同的设备可能支持不同的数据位长度。 6. 停止位长度和CRC校验 停止位用于标记一个字符的结束,并且有0,1,2,1.5等多种长度选择。CRC校验码的追加能提供更为强大的错误检测功能。CRC(循环冗余校验)是一种基于多项式除法的校验技术,能够检测数据传输或存储过程中的错误。 7. 硬件流控制 串口通信中,硬件流控制(如RTS/CTS、DTR/DSR)用于防止数据的丢失。该工具支持硬件流控制,允许用户启用或禁用这些控制线,以匹配连接的设备和确保数据交换的顺利进行。 8. 快捷键与定时发送功能 为了提高用户的操作效率,串口调试工具集成了丰富的快捷键。这些快捷键可以让用户快速执行常用功能,比如开始/停止串口通信、清除数据缓冲区等。自动定时发送功能允许用户设置定时任务,以自动化数据的发送过程,对于周期性数据的发送非常有用。 9. 发送新行 在进行某些特定通信,如发送AT指令到调制解调器时,发送新行功能可以模拟按下Enter键的动作,确保发送的命令能够正确执行。 10. 软件版本与安装说明 该文件提供的工具版本为*.**.*.***14 LTSC,适用于32位架构(x86)。安装文件名为SerialPortTool.2.19.Installer.x86,适合在运行Windows操作系统的计算机上安装。"LTSC"可能指的是"Long-Term Servicing Channel",表示这是长期支持的版本,通常用于企业环境,其中的更新和功能改进不会频繁发布,但会有更长时间的支持周期。